Transaction 64b40bd7902cc642ad2f6ecbf46ecd5c8267214d3bd2df33d7297d2c52b441f5

1 Input
2 Outputs
  • 64b40bd7902cc642ad2f6ecbf46ecd5c8267214d3bd2df33d7297d2c52b441f5:0
  • value  2000000
    address  1EZc2NDh2kg1hPKYb3PARvq7k6rxZH8B2v
  • 64b40bd7902cc642ad2f6ecbf46ecd5c8267214d3bd2df33d7297d2c52b441f5:1
  • value  20673006
    address  1HhLyPDWvzG27TWgUNNU3e95sornCgmHLT